Spiked Apple Cider with Bourbon

This cozy spiked apple cider with bourbon is the ultimate fall drink, combining fresh apple cider, warming spices, and smooth bourbon for gatherings or quiet nights. It’s quick to make, naturally gluten-free, and easily customizable for all tastes.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 quart (4 cups) fresh apple cider
  • 3/4 cup bourbon (use 1/2 cup for lighter flavor)
  • 2 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ar (optional, recommended)
  • 23 cinnamon sticks (or 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on)
  • 68 whole cloves (or pinch ground cloves)
  • 1 whole star anise (optional)
  • 46 allspice berries (or 1/2 teaspoon ground allspice, optional)
  • Peel from 1 orange (wide strips)
  • Apple slices, for garnish
  • Additional cinnamon sticks, for serving

Instructions

  1. Pour apple cider into a large saucepan or Dutch oven. Add maple syrup and brown sugar. Stir gently to dissolve.
  2. Add cinnamon sticks, cloves, star anise, allspice berries, and orange peel. Stir to combine.
  3. Set over medium heat and bring to a gentle simmer (5-7 minutes). Do not boil.
  4. Reduce heat to low and steep for 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  5. Taste and adjust sweetness or spice as desired.
  6. Strain out spices and orange peel using a fine mesh strainer.
  7. Off the heat, stir in bourbon. Mix gently.
  8. Ladle hot cider into mugs. Garnish with apple slices and cinnamon sticks.
  9. Serve immediately and enjoy. Keep warm on low heat or in a slow cooker if serving a crowd.

Notes

For a non-alcoholic version, skip the bourbon and add a splash of vanilla extract. Adjust sweetness and spice to taste. Use local, unfiltered cider for best flavor. Keep below a boil to preserve freshness. Store leftovers in the fridge for up to 3 days; reheat gently before serving.
